Weather and Climate in Valley Cottage
Seasonal Temperatures: Valley Cottage has a typical summer high of 81°F and a winter low of 17°F. And the yearly rainfall here is about 50 inches, while the snowfall is around 28 inch(es) on average.
Air Quality: The Average air quality index rating is usually 59, which is higher than the national average of 58.The index rating at or below 100 is considered satisfactory.

Common Home Care Services
The typical home care services or facilities may vary depending on the specific needs of the older adult receiving care. However, some regular services offered by home care providers that include assistance with activities of daily living (ADLs) such as bathing, dressing, grooming, and toileting. Medication management, including reminders to take medications and meal preparation with feeding assistance.

There are as many as 5 means to pay for home care services for seniors. They include:
Private pay options (out of pocket payments)
Paying by yourself is the most frequent method of payment. However, it's not a simple choice to adopt. To cover the cost, you may need to utilize your money or dispose of some of your other assets. Nonetheless, it's not rare to take this route to cover such charges.
Long-Term Care Insurance (LTCI)
Long-term care insurance (LTCI) is often an excellent resource to finance home care. However, take caution that not all LTCI plans are alike. Some may not cover all your charges; therefore, talk to your insurance provider and acquire information ahead of time.
Private health insurance
There are several private health insurances available for elderly individuals to enroll in. They will differ from state to state. Thus, it is recommended to look into your state page on our platform and discover particular home care payment options.
VA benefits
The U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s offers veterans VA Aid & Attendance benefits. Confirm if you are eligible for them. To be eligible for VA Aid & Attendance privileges for home care, veterans must meet particular requirements including having a service-connected disability or being unable to leave their home due to a health condition. If you are, this pension can fund a big part of your Home Care payments. Visit the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s website to get thorough information.
